Ingredients for Homemade Cheez It Crackers
Before starting the process, collect these essential ingredients.
Ingredient List
Ingredient | Quantity | Notes |
---|---|---|
Sharp Cheddar Cheese | 8 oz (225g) grated | Provides that signature cheesy flavor. |
Unsalted Butter | 4 tbsp (57g) | Cold and cubed for a flaky texture. |
All-Purpose Flour | 1 cup (120g) | Forms the base of your dough. |
Salt | 1/2 teaspoon | Adjust based on taste preference. |
Paprika (optional) | 1/4 teaspoon | Adds color and a subtle kick. |
Water | 2–3 tablespoons | Helps bind the dough. |
Tools You’ll Need
You don’t need fancy equipment to nail this recipe. These common kitchen tools will get the job done:
- Food processor: Essential for blending ingredients into a smooth dough.
- Rolling pin: Helps you achieve the ideal cracker thickness.
- Parchment paper: Keeps the dough from sticking and makes cleanup a breeze.
- Baking sheet: For crisp, evenly baked crackers.
- Pastry cutter or sharp knife: Ensures uniform cracker shapes.
Step-by-Step Instructions
Ready to dive in? Follow these straightforward steps to create homemade Cheez its crackers that rival the originals.
Step 1: Prepare the Dough
- Combine Ingredients: Begin by adding the grated cheese, butter, flour, salt, and paprika to your food processor. Pulse until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
- Add Water Gradually: Slowly incorporate water, one tablespoon at a time, while pulsing the processor. The dough should come together without becoming sticky.
- Chill the Dough: Tightly wrap the dough in pl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es. Chilling makes it easier to roll out later.
Step 2: Roll Out and Cut
- Preheat the Oven: Set your oven to 175°C.
- Roll the Dough: Place the chilled dough between two sheets of parchment paper and roll it out to a thickness of about 1/8 inch.
- Cut into Squares: Use a pastry cutter or a sharp knife to slice the dough into small, 1-inch squares. For an authentic Cheez-It appearance, strive for neat and uniform shapes.
Step 3: Bake to Perfection
- Arrange on Baking Sheet: Place the squares on a parchment-lined baking sheet, leaving a bit of space between each piece.
- Poke Holes: Use a toothpick or skewer to poke a hole in the center of each square—this not only looks authentic but also prevents puffing during baking.
- Bake: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the crackers are golden brown and crispy.
- Cool Completely: Let the crackers cool on a wire rack before storing them.
Pro Tips and Variations
Pro Tips for Perfect Crackers:
- Use cold butter: Cold butter creates tiny steam pockets as it melts, giving the crackers a flaky, crisp texture.
- Grate cheese yourself: Pre-shredded cheese has anti-caking agents that prevent it from melting smoothly. Freshly grated cheese gives the best flavor and texture.
- Don’t overwork the dough: Over-mixing develops gluten, which makes crackers tough instead of crunchy. Handle just enough to bring it together.
- Roll dough evenly: Consistent 1/8-inch thickness ensures crackers bake evenly — too thick stays soft, too thin burns quickly.
- Bake until golden brown: Color = crunch. The darker the edges (without burning), the crispier the crackers will be.
Variations to Try:
- Cheese Variety:
- Sharp Cheddar: The classic choice for that rich, tangy flavor.
- Parmesan: Swap cheddar for parmesan for a more savory, nutty taste.
- Pepper Jack: Spice things up with pepper jack for a zesty kick.
- Gouda: Use gouda for a smooth, creamy flavor with a slightly smoky undertone.
- Flavor Add-ins:
- Garlic Powder: A popular addition for a savory punch.
- Onion Powder: Perfect for adding a mild, sweet onion flavor.
- Cayenne Pepper: For those who like a spicy kick, sprinkle in a pinch of cayenne pepper.
- Dried Herbs: Basil, thyme, or rosemary can elevate your crackers to a more gourmet level.
- Lemon Zest: For a fresh, citrusy twist, add a touch of lemon zest to the dough.
- Gluten-Free Option:
- For a gluten-free version, replace the all-purpose flour with a gluten-free 1:1 baking flour. This will slightly change the texture, but the flavor will still be just as delicious. Add xanthan gum if needed to help with structure.
- Vegan Version:
- Dairy-Free Cheese: Substitute the sharp cheddar with a dairy-free cheese of your choice.
- Vegan Butter: Swap out the unsalted butter for a plant-based alternative to make this recipe completely vegan-friendly.
- Flaxseed for Binding: If you prefer a vegan egg alternative, try using ground flaxseed mixed with water as a binding agent.
- Herb-Infused Crust:
- For a more fragrant, savory crust, add finely chopped fresh herbs like rosemary, thyme, or sage into the dough for extra flavor and a rustic touch.
- Sweet Version:
- For a fun twist, you can make a sweet version of these crackers by adding a little sugar and cinnamon to the dough. These would be great paired with a cup of tea or as a snack for the kids!
With these variations and tips, you can easily customize your homemade Cheez It crackers to suit your tastes or dietary needs. Get creative and make them your own!

Troubleshooting Common Problems (FAQ)
Why is my dough too crumbly and not coming together?
It needs more liquid. Add 1 teaspoon of ice water at a time, mixing gently until the dough holds when squeezed. Don’t over-mix.
Why did my crackers turn out soft instead of crispy?
They were likely rolled too thick or under-baked. Roll dough to 1/8-inch thickness and bake until the edges are deep golden brown.
How do I make these without a food processor?
Use a pastry blender or two knives to cut cold butter into the flour-cheese mixture until it looks like coarse crumbs. Stir in ice water until dough forms.
